Output d5bfcc35bae7757b6c82146c203283e19e9a9b60ec6ad7fad7e679c6ae52eb3f:10

value
18650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b039438cfe627be57a1cb39c9151891165f30ac OP_EQUAL
address
3CuTKp2WiFSJTwvJowF6R6Ac4Qw6dB4h6r
transaction
d5bfcc35bae7757b6c82146c203283e19e9a9b60ec6ad7fad7e679c6ae52eb3f
spent
true